Lickety Split Banana Split
This fun, kid-friendly breakfast is a healthy twist on an ice cream classic.
- 1 Servings
- Less than $3.00
Ingredients
- 1 banana
- 1/2 cup non-fat strawberry yogurt
- 1/2 cup whole-grain cereal
- 1/4 cup seedless grapes, halved
- 1/4 cup strawberries, sliced
Steps
1
Wash hands with soap and water.
2
Peel and cut the banana in half, lengthwise.
3
Place the banana on a plate.
4
Top banana with yogurt and sprinkle with cereal and fruit.

Serving Size: 1 serving
Nutrients | Amount |
---|---|
Total Calories | 341 |
Total Fat | 2 g |
Saturated Fat | 1 g |
Monounsaturated Fat | 0 g |
Polyunsaturated Fat | 1 g |
Linoleic Acid | 1 g |
α-Linolenic Acid | 0.1 g |
Omega 3 - EPA | 0 mg |
Omega 3 - DHA | 0 mg |
Cholesterol | 2 mg |
Carbohydrates | 83 g |
Dietary Fiber | 13 g |
Total Sugars | 50 g |
Added Sugars included | 18 g |
Protein | 11 g |
Minerals | |
Calcium | 323 mg |
Potassium | 1112 mg |
Sodium | 153 mg |
Copper | 496 mcg |
Iron | 6 mg |
Magnesium | 170 mg |
Phosphorus | 546 mg |
Selenium | 12 mcg |
Zinc | 5 mg |
Vitamins | |
Vitamin A | 169 mcg RAE |
Vitamin B6 | 4.3 mg |
Vitamin B12 | 6.4 mg |
Vitamin C | 43 mg |
Vitamin D | 2 mcg |
Vitamin E | 1 mg |
Vitamin K | 10 mcg |
Folate | 727 mcg DFE |
Thiamin | 0.8 mg |
Riboflavin | 1.2 mg |
Niacin | 6 mg |
Choline | 51 mg |
